Transaction 3bfa08b0a987852fc9f80787e7ae54a9300775cd00a4dbfc7a68b6323b6e9c57
1 Input
1 Output
-
3bfa08b0a987852fc9f80787e7ae54a9300775cd00a4dbfc7a68b6323b6e9c57:0
- value
- 1397263
- script pubkey
- OP_0 OP_PUSHBYTES_20 1dcb332a33d0d52aeb7374ddd42dca9379e444ad
- address
- bc1qrh9nx23n6r2j46mnwnwagtw2jdu7g39dek679y